PRPI (Perpetual Industries) EV-to-OCF: -7.61 (As of Jul. 08, 2026)


What is Perpetual Industries EV-to-OCF?

Perpetual Industries PRPI +0.03% EV-to-OCF is -7.61 as of Jul. 08, 2026.

EV-to-OCF is calculated as enterprise value divided by its cash flow from operations. As of today, Perpetual Industries's Enterprise Value is $1.44 Mil. Perpetual Industries's Cash Flow from Operations for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2022 was $-0.19 Mil. Therefore, Perpetual Industries's EV-to-OCF for today is -7.61.

Enterprise Value is used because it is a more complete measure in reflecting how much an investor pays when buying a company. Cash Flow from Operations is an important financial metric because it represents the cash generated from operating activities at a company's disposal. Companies with a low EV-to-OCF ratio, combined with a strong balance sheet are generally considered as undervalued.

Perpetual Industries EV-to-OCF Calculation

Perpetual Industries's EV-to-OCF for today is calculated as:

EV-to-OCF=Enterprise Value (Today)/Cash Flow from Operations (TTM)
=1.439/-0.189
=-7.61

Perpetual Industries's current Enterprise Value is $1.44 Mil.
For company reported semi-annually, GuruFocus uses latest annual data as the TTM data. Perpetual Industries's Cash Flow from Operations for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2022 was $-0.19 Mil.

Perpetual Industries Business Description

Address 2193 Rotunda Drive, Auburn, IN, USA, 46706
Perpetual Industries Inc is a U.S.-based company focused on the growth and market expansion of its wholly owned subsidiary, The Worldwide Group, LLC, which operates as Worldwide Auctioneers, is a boutique auction firm specializing in the sale and acquisition of classic and vintage motorcars, generating its primary revenues through live and online auctions held across the United States. The company serves a clientele of automotive collectors and enthusiasts. Along with its auction events, the company offers a comprehensive suite of personalized services, including private car sales appraisals, collection management, estate planning, and asset consultancy.
